215 Beltway at Lake Mead reopened after crash
July 30, 2015 - 12:59 pm
A motorist suffered serious injuries — but is expected to survive — in a crash on south 215 Beltway just before the Lake Mead Boulevard exit Thursday morning, according to the Nevada Highway Patrol.
Troopers and emergency workers were called about 11:30 a.m. to the wreck that involved a truck and and an Oldsmobile sedan, NHP trooper Chelsea Stuenkel said. The woman driving the sedan was taken to University Medical Center with injuries not deemed life-threatening.
The crash blocked the right lanes but was being cleared about 1 p.m., Stuenkel said.
